| 1 | Landscape of DILI-related adverse drug reaction in China Mainland显示文摘Drug-induced liver injury(DILI)is a type of bizarre adverse drug reaction(ADR)damaging liver(L-ADR)which may lead to substantial hospitalizations and mortality.Due to the general low incidence,detection of L-ADR remains an unsolved public health challenge.Therefore,we used the data of 6.673 million of ADR reports from January 1st,2012 to December 31st,2016 in China National ADR Monitoring System to establish a new database of L-ADR reports for future investigation.Results showed that totally 114,357 ADR reports were retrieved by keywords searching of liver-related injuries from the original heterogeneous system.By cleaning and standardizing the data fields by the dictionary of synonyms and English translation,we resulted 94,593 ADR records reported to liver injury and then created a new database ready for computer mining.The reporting status of L-ADR showed a persistent 1.62-fold change over the past five years.The national population-adjusted reporting numbers of L-ADR manifested an upward trend with age increasing and more evident in men.The annual reporting rate of L-ADR in age group over 80 years old strikingly exceeded the annual DILI incidence rate in general population,despite known underreporting situation in spontaneous ADR reporting system.The percentage of herbal and traditional medicines(H/TM)L-ADR reports in the whole number was 4.5%,while 80.60%of the H/TM reports were new findings.There was great geographical disparity of reported agents,i.e.more cardiovascular and antineoplastic agents were reported in higher socio-demographic index(SDI)regions and more antimicrobials,especially antitubercular agents,were reported in lower SDI regions.In conclusion,this study presented a large-scale,unbiased,unified,and computer-minable L-ADR database for further investigation.Age-,sex-and SDI-related risks of L-ADR incidence warrant to emphasize the precise pharmacovigilance policies within China or other regions in the world. | Jiabo Wang Haibo Song Feilin Ge Peng Xiong Jing Jing Tingting He Yuming Guo Zhuo Shi Chao Zhou Zixin Han Yanzhong Han Ming Niu Zhaofang Bai Guangbin Luo Chuanyong Shen Xiaohe Xiao | 2022 | Acta Pharmaceutica Sinica B2022,12,12: | 12 |
| 2 | The template preparation and characterization of three new shapes of titania nanometer-array systems显示文摘A two-step anodization process was used to prepare highly ordered porous anodic alu- mina template (PAA). The template method was combined with the sol-electrophoresis deposition and sol-gel method to synthesize three types of nano- meter-array systems. The titania nano-arrays have a high specific surface area. The sol-gel template method was also applied to prepare the rod-shaped titania nanowire-arrays. The diameter of titania nanometer-array is about 50 nm; the length is about 20 μm; and the distance of neighboring two nanowires is about 100 nm. Through controlling the pore depth of the template, the membrane with peri- odical modulating titania nanodots was prepared. The diameter of the nanodots on the membrane surface was about 75 nm and the dot distance was about 100 nm. Also a compact structure has been found on the back face of the membrane. The sol-electrophoresis template method was used to prepare the nanowire-array system with the shape of string of candied haws. The diameter of nanowires was about 75 nm and the length was about 20 μm. The periodic concave-convex structures were found in each nanowire and the shape looked like string of candied haws. The three types of nano-array systems have a high specific surface area. It can be predicted that this type of surface modulating array system will have new properties and effects that are different from those of common membranes, nanodots and nanowires. | TIAN Yuming XU Mingxia LIU Xiangzhi GE Lei | 2006 | Chinese Science Bulletin2006,51,12: | 4 |
| 3 | Catalytic Oxidative Desulfurization of Gasoline Using Vanadium(V)-substituted Polyoxometalate/H_2O_2/Ionic Liquid Emulsion System显示文摘Aiming at deep desulfurization of gasoline,three amphiphilic catalysts [C18H37N(CH3)3]3+x [PMo12-xVxO40](x=1,2,or 3) were prepared and characterized.The amphiphilic vanadium(V)-substituted polyoxometalates were dissolved in water-immiscible ionic liquid([Bmim]PF6),forming a H2O2-in-[Bmim]PF6 emulsion desulfurization system with 30 m% H2O2 serving as the oxidant.The catalytic oxidation of sulfur-containing model oil has been studied in detail under various reaction conditions using this system.The ionic liquid emulsion system showed high catalytic oxidative activity in the treatment of commodity gasoline.Furthermore,the mechanism of catalytic oxidative desulfurization was also elaborated. | Ge Jianhua Zhou Yuming Yang Yong Xue Mengwei | 2012 | China Petroleum Processing & Petrochemical Technology2012,14,1: | 2 |

| 9 | Nickel-decorated TiO2 nanotube arrays as a self-supporting cathode for lithium-sulfur batteries显示文摘Lithium-sulfur batteries are considered to be one of the strong competitors to replace lithium-ion batteries due to their large energy density.However,the dissolution of discharge intermediate products to the electrolyte,the volume change and poor electric conductivity of sulfur greatly limit their further commercialization.Herein,we proposed a self-supporting cathode of nickel-decorated TiO2 nanotube arrays(TiO2 NTs@Ni)prepared by an anodization and electrodeposition method.The TiO2 NTs with large specific surface area provide abundant reaction space and fast transmission channels for ions and electrons.Moreover,the introduction of nickel can enhance the electric conductivity and the polysulfide adsorption ability of the cathode.As a result,the TiO2 NTs@Ni-S electrode exhibits significant improvement in cycling and rate performance over TiO2 NTs,and the discharge capacity of the cathode maintains 719 mA·h·g−1 after 100 cycles at 0.1 C. | Yuming Chen Wenhao Tang Jingru Ma Ben Ge Xiangliang Wang Yufen Wang Pengfei Ren Ruiping Liu | 2020 | Frontiers of Materials Science2020,14,3: | 0 |
